IEEE 802.1Q is the networking standard that defines VLAN (Virtual Local Area Network) tagging on Ethernet frames. VLANs allow network administrators to segment a physical network into multiple logical networks, improving security, efficiency, and management. The 802.1Q standard introduces VLAN tagging to facilitate communication between VLANs across different network switches. Furthermore, to begin with PVLAN, lets look at the concept of VLAN as a broadcast domain. In general VLAN is a concept of segregating a physical network, so that separate broadcast domains can be created. Private VLANs (PVANs) will split the primary VLAN domain also a segregated network into multiple isolated broadcast sub-domains. Furthermore, actually in vlan header contains TPID (16 bits),PCP (3 bits),CFI (1 bit)and VID (12 bits). in vlans we are using vlan id's for transport of traffic from one switch to another switch. so the vlan id i.e vlan identifier is 12 bits. output2124096. (in binary format).but we are using traffic of multiple vlans from 1 to 4094 at a time only.the remaining two bits is reserved i.e 0 and 4095.
